A Ticking Clock Over in Redmond

Speculation mounts that Steve Ballmer may soon be out.

It the end, it's not Windows Vista, or Zune, or any other bungled consumer product that may spell doom for Microsoft CEO Steve Ballmer. But a stock that's fallen nearly 50 percent since he took over in 2000? Cue the ominous music. The Daily Beast has an interesting article that reports on the increasingly vocal grumbling over in Redmond among some senior managers, many of whom have most of their wealth tied up in the flagging Microsoft stock. Is a coup in the works? Hard to say, even by the insiders the Beast talks to. But the drums are getting louder.
